advice an idea or opinion that someone gives to help you decide.
builder a person who puts things together to make something, especially houses or other structures that people live or work in.
chalk a type of soft, white stone. Chalk is made into long thin shapes used for writing or drawing.
cheese a solid food made from milk.
correct with no mistakes.
heap many things lying on top of each other; pile.
heaven (usually plural) the sky, including the stars, sun, moon, and planets as seen from the earth.
middle halfway between two things, places, or points.
ore a rock or mineral from which a metal or other useful substance can be removed.
peak the highest part of a mountain, or the highest part of anything.
scrape to rub with something sharp or rough.
ski to glide over snow wearing a pair of long, narrow, smooth runners attached to boots.
smile to have an expression on the face in which the corners of the mouth turn up.
straw dried stems of certain grain plants. Straw is used to feed farm animals and to make things such as baskets and hats.
write to form letters or words on a surface with a pen, pencil, or some other thing.
